Dr. Jonathan Makanjuola, on behalf of Lateral Flow Bermuda and our local partner in this initiative APEX Physio has written to all the Local respective Sports Administrators,
Dr. Makanjuola wrote, “Thank you for taking the time on a busy weekend to attend the Return to Sport meeting organized by Maceo Dill on behalf of the Department of Youth Sport and Recreation.
As stated, we want to see Bermuda open again and sports is a mainstay to this happening. As a result, we wish to align our efforts together with sports organizations in Bermuda as a collective to secure the best price point that is sustainable for operation. It is my understanding, the new guidelines, using lateral flow tests, have been released in the public domain which mirrors some aspects currently being used in the school system.
Please see our unit pricing. We will hold all orders from any sporting organization, local team, National Sports Governing Bodies (NSGB) or its affiliates to allow us to secure an aggregate order as we push towards 10,000. The idea is to work together to secure the lowest number price per unit.
In this case, if we fall short of the 10,000 unit orders, we will be at the next tier price per unit indicated below. Our mission remains to provide low cost, affordable, high quality lateral flow tests for everyone in Bermuda. The Flow Flex lateral flow test is approved for use by the Bermuda Health Council, UK, EU and US FDA. Over the past two weeks, working hard with the supply chain we have systematically secured lower price points - true to our mission we pass these savings to the consumer. We will continue to employ this approach.
$4.95 over 10,000 units $5.20 for greater than 1,000 units
The cutoff date to secure these price points is 5pm Thursday, October 14th. This date enables us to have the order on the island ready for use in phase 4a and 4b.
